The programme of Regional Activities started to be implemented in kindergartens in 2014,
while in primary schools it started a year later, in the school year 2015/2016. The
programme proposal comprises first to eight grade pupils attending the compulsory
primary school education and it was prepared by the Working Group for the conduction
and implementation of the project. The project includes aims, tasks, learning outcomes
and suggests teaching units which will help both teachers and expert associates in schools
in the conduction of the Programme. In the 2016/2017 school year regional education was
also accepted by some secondary schools in Istria.
At the level of the Republic of Croatia, in the August of 2014, the Ministry of Science,
Education and Sport accepted the Programme of Intercurricular and Interdisciplinary
Contents of Citizenship Education in Primary and Secondary Schools (hereinafter:
Citizenship Education) which started to be conducted in the 2014/2015 school year. The
Programme states that it is possible to incorporate regional education in contents where
culture and creativity are linked to the freedom of participating in both cultural life and in
discussions about the contribution of different cultures to the world’s cultural heritage
(2014). Citizenship Education contents are part of compulsory implementation (15 hours a
year out of 35 hours)4 as part of intercurricular contents belonging to school subjects:
Croatian language, Music, Art, Foreign languages, Mathematics, Science, Physical
education, Religious education and expert associates’ programmes. It is, though, an issue
of integrating and correlating contents with the aim of developing the curricular and
citizenship competency at the same time.
The units and topics part of the subject Music are: Music as the symbol of cultural values
of the national, European and world culture, Croatian and Croatian national minorities’
traditional music, Folklore music, Meeting the native land – a visit to the museum
collection. In the fourth grade of primary school there is a mention of a research and design
of a report about innovators, discoverers and meritorious citizens in their region or wider,
as well as getting to know the dances of our region and a visit to cultural-artistic societies
of our town (Gortan - Carlin, Radiæ, 2016).
